Reverend John Ntim Fordjour a Member of Parliament’s Foreign Affairs Committee, has summoned MPs to take a stand against any effort to legalize homosexuality in Ghana.
His statements follow support from a group of eight Ghanaians in Canada who have appealed to the Canadian government to put pressure on Ghana to legalize homosexuality.
On Wednesday, the Assin South MP addressed the press in Parliament and urged the country to stick to its position not to legalize homosexuality regardless of international pressure.
“…Without prejudice to the position of the Parliament of Ghana, Government of Ghana, any religious body or political party on the subject of homosexuality, lesbianism and bestiality, premised on my deepest convictions and principles as a Christian, Reverend Minister and a proud advocate of Jesus Christ and legislator, Member of Parliament for Assin South constituency, I hereby openly, and unequivocally declare my firm position against the views of the members of an advocacy group who on Thursday, August 17, 2017 sought to canvass support from certain powerful persons in institutions in Canada to put pressure on Ghana to decriminalize homosexuality.”

Mr. Fordjour who is also the Chairman of Ghana-Canada Parliamentary Friendship Association described the acts by the eight Ghanaians as a “demonic agenda, “He also said such deeds defile the traditions and customs of the country.
He further stated; “It is worth stating that the constitution of Ghana makes adequate provision which debar homosexuality, lesbianism, bestiality and such acts that defile the core tenets of our beliefs, values, customs and traditions as a people,” The issue over Ghana’s legalization of homosexuality continues to be an incessant debate in the country.
Whereas some human rights activists call for its legalization, others argue against it.
